IPL 2024: Facts about Nitish Kumar Reddy; SRH’s rising batting sensation
Nitish Kumar Reddy (Image Source: Instagram)

In a thrilling Indian Premeir League (IPL) 2024 encounter between Sunrisers Hyderabad (SRH) and Punjab Kings (PBKS), Nitish Kumar Reddy emerged as a standout performer, showcasing his explosive batting prowess. Despite facing a formidable Punjab side led by Shikhar Dhawan, SRH managed to register a nail-biting 2 runs victory in Mullanpur on Tuesday (April 9).

Early setback: Top-order collapse for SRH

In a fiercely contested match where Punjab’s Arshdeep Singh and Sam Curran wreaked havoc with the ball, causing a top-order collapse for SRH, notable names like Abhishek Sharma, Rahul Tripathi (11) and the usually reliable Heinrich Klaasen failed to make significant contributions with the bat. However, amidst the batting turmoil, Nitish emerged as SRH’s shining light, delivering a remarkable performance.

Nitish Kumar Reddy’s explosive batting display

With a career-best score of 64 runs off just 37 balls, Reddy showcased his attacking style of play, smashing five sixes and four fours at a remarkable strike rate of 172.97. His brilliant performance played a pivotal role in SRH posting a challenging total of runs in their allotted 20 overs, ultimately securing a crucial victory in the IPL 2024 campaign.

Here are the interesting facts about SRH’s batting dynamo Nitish Kumar Reddy:

  • Early Life and Family Background: Nitish was born on May 26, 2023, in Vishakhapatnam, Andhra Pradesh, to K. Mutyala Reddy, a former employee of Hindustan Zinc, and Manasa Jyotsna. He grew up alongside his sister, Sharmila Reddy.

  • Early Introduction to Cricket: Nitish’s tryst with cricket began at the tender age of 5 when he started playing the sport. He was drawn to the Hindustan Zinc ground, where he avidly watched senior players, laying the foundation for his cricketing aspirations.
  • Transition and Training: Nitish’s father made a pivotal decision to quit his job and relocate to Udaipur when Nitish was around 10-12 years old. This move was driven by his concern over the quality of training Nitish would receive at the new workplace. Subsequently, Nitish was admitted to the Visakhapatnam District Cricket Association (VDCA) camp under the Andhra Cricket Association, initiating his formal training sessions.
  • Spotting Talent: Nitish’s talent caught the eye of former Indian cricketer and selector MSK Prasad during Under-12 and Under-14 age group matches. He was selected to train at the ACA academy in Kadapa under the coaching of Madhusudhana Reddy and Srinivasa Rao, marking a significant milestone in his cricketing journey.
  • Record-Breaking Performance: Nitish’s exceptional performance in the Vijay Merchant Trophy 2017-18 was nothing short of extraordinary. Scoring a remarkable 441 runs against Nagaland and ending the tournament with 1237 runs at an average of 176.41, along with 26 wickets, earned him the prestigious Board of Control for Cricket in India (BCCI) ‘Best Cricketer in the Under-16’ Jagmohan Dalmiya award, making him the pride of the Andhra Cricket Association as he became the first player from Andhra to recieved that award

  • First-Class Debut and Impressive Start: Nitish made his first-class debut for Andhra Pradesh in the 2019-2020 Ranji Trophy against Kerala. His debut match was marked by a noteworthy performance, including a crucial catch of Basil Thampi and his maiden first-class wicket in form of Ponnan Rahul, showcasing his potential as a promising cricketer.
  • Vijay Hazare Trophy Debut and IPL Exposure: Nitish further solidified his credentials with a stellar debut in the Vijay Hazare Trophy 2020-21 against Vidarbha, where he smashed a fifty, scoring 54 runs off 58 balls. His talent was recognized by the Chennai Super Kings (CSK), who selected him as a net player, affording him the opportunity to train with the team in Dubai in September 2021.
  • IPL Debut and Fulfilling a Dream: In a momentous turn of events, the SRH team signed Nitish ahead of the IPL 2023 edition in the auction of IPL 2022. His dream of sharing the field with his idol, Virat Kohli, came true when he made his IPL debut against Royal Challengers Bengaluru (RCB) in May 2023, marking an unforgettable milestone in his cricketing journey.
